Unser Lagerbier ist die bekannteste Rauchbiersorte aus unserem Spezialitätenangebot. Das bernsteinfarbige Bier mit seinem feinem, mildem Rauchgeschmack lässt auch Skeptiker zum überzeugten Rauchbierfan werden. Der Stammwürzgehalt dieses Bieres beträgt ca.12% - daraus resultiert der Alkoholgehalt mit ca.4,7%

Poured and drunk at the source in Septembr 2023.

L: Bright copper colour with lighter highlights where the sun plays on the beer. Thin, mocha-colour head. No carbonation in the glass.

S: Rich, smoked ham. Minerally. Actually exactly what I was expecting!

T: Largely follows the nose, with the addition of burnt toffee. Some mild dry tobacco notes too. Mildly bitter and finishes very quickly and dryly.

M: The mouthfeel is slightly thin. Carbonation is mild to medium.

O: A very approachable Rauchbier dialled back on the smoke but still with enough to keep novice and experienced Rauchbier drinkers alike satisfied.

Pours a very slightly cloudy, deep amber coloration with a medium, creamy head. Smells of smoked, bready malt and honey-glazed ham, with some grassy, herbal hops also coming through. Taste is a good balance of smoked, bready malt and grassy, herbal, slightly floral hops, with the smoke note being reminiscent of smoked, honey-glazed ham. Finishes with a light/medium bitterness and some smoked, honey-glazed ham lingering in the aftertaste. Smooth mouthfeel with a light/medium body and medium carbonation.

This is a decent enough Rauchbier, but doesn't compare to Schlenkerla in my opinion, because the smoke isn't nearly as distinct and more reminiscent of honey-glazed smoked ham than campfire smoked bacon, while the whole balance is a bit on the sweeter side, although not too bad with some slightly bitter, grassy, herbal hops providing a certain counterpoint here. Overall an enjoyable example of the style that's a bit more light and sweet than Schlenkerla's offerings, with a somewhat different and more subtle smoke note.
